  1. Spanish exile returns (1977)

    Genre
    News report

    Richard Wallace reports on the return to Spain from exile of Dolores Ibarruri (nicknamed La Passionara), president of the Spanish Communist Party, after 38 years in the Soviet Union (returned on 13/05/77).
